WebScientific Objectives. Nitric oxide is an important minor constituent of the upper atmosphere that exhibits strong solar-terrestrial coupling. Nitric oxide directly affects the composition of the ionosphere, the thermal structure of the thermosphere, and may be transported downward into the mesosphere and stratosphere where it can react with ozone. WebNitric oxide then reacts rapidly with excess oxygen to give nitrogen dioxide, the compound responsible for the brown color of smog: Equation 4.46 2NO (g) + O2(g) → 2NO2(g) When nitrogen dioxide dissolves in water, it forms a 1:1 mixture of nitrous acid and nitric acid: Equation 4.47 2NO2(g) + H2O (l) → HNO2(aq) + HNO3(aq)

WebOzone (O3) is a gas composed of three oxygen atoms. It is not usually emitted directly into the air, but at ground level is created by a chemical reaction between oxides of nitrogen (NOx) and volatile organic compounds (VOC) in the presence of heat and sunlight.
